NVDA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2023 in Review

3,680 of the 6,303 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in NVIDIA (NVDA) for Q3 2023, worth a combined $710B — up 2.6% from $692B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 263 funds opened new NVDA positions and 110 closed out — a net gain of 153 holders — while 1,608 added to existing stakes and 1,500 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Capital World Investors, adding an estimated $1.27B. The largest seller was State Street, cutting an estimated $1.27B.
